    Huddersfield Town Academy Strategy - A New Direction

    The Town Academy has recategorized itself from a Category 2 system under the Elite Player Performance Plan to a Category 4 system. This will refocus the Club’s efforts on the higher Academy age groups where it has had its success in recent years with the progression of the likes of Tommy Smith and Philip Billing; both who joined Town post-16 years old.

    The Club has switched its age groupings to echo the European model, with Under-19 and Under-17 groups running alongside an Elite Development Team (EDT) for its older talents.

    The Academy, under the leadership of Leigh Bromby, has also re-banded its age categories to fit the calendar year as opposed to the Academic year to try and combat relative age effect, which shows Academy age groups are usually full of August to December birthdays due to their physical development.

    The EDT and Under-19 sides will play bespoke, tailored games programmes that will be put together to challenge Town’s young players, whilst the Under-17s will receive the physical stimulus of playing against Under-18 sides in league action.

    Exploring the Future of Football at our Academy

    Bio-Banding is an innovative way of grouping young football players according to their physical maturity rather than their age has been demonstrated to show big benefits when it comes to spotting hidden talent and reducing injuries.

    Bio-banding is a strategy which has existed for a number of years but has only recently been trialled by clubs in the UK – groups players according to their maturity level. This means youth teams are mixed when it comes to ages, but roughly equal when it comes to how physically developed players are. It is designed to avoid the David and Goliath situation whereby a late developing child is pitched against an early developed child, who has an advantage in size and strength.

    Advocates suggest bio-banding should not completely replace traditional practices which group players by age. But they suggest bio-banding can be an additional coaching tool used to better identify and retain talented yet late maturing athletes and can expose early and late developers to new challenges and learning opportunities.

    A guide to the Elite Player Performance Plan

    What is the EPPP?

    The Elite Player Performance Plan is an ambitious long-term vision with the aim of giving English football the ability to create the best Academy system in the world, allowing clubs to produce more and better quality home grown players.
    It has been developed after consultations with Academy Managers, Premier League clubs, the Football League, the Football Association, and other key stakeholders within the game.

    Football Academies were audited by an external company Double pass, judged against the EPPP’s classification system, and put into one of four categories – the highest of which will give clubs more opportunity to extend its elite environment and make more strategic decisions.

    The new classification replaced the old two-tier model of Academies and Centre of Excellence systems, and has seen a major change in the way that youth football is delivered in this country.

    Classification

    Category One - Regular graduation of players into the Premier League and wider professional game with up to 8,500 coaching hours

    Category Two - Graduation of players into the Premier League and Championship from time to time and regular graduates into the wider game with up to 6,600 coaching hours

    Category Three - Graduation of players regularly into the professional game predominantly in Leagues one and two and players potentially capable of progression into Cat One and Cat Two Academies with up to 3,600 coaching hours

    Category Four - Graduation of players into the professional game League two and semi-professional level with up to 3,200 coaching hours

    The Premier League, The Football League and the Football Association invest an increased amount of central income into Youth Development nationwide, so the higher the classification given to the club in the EPPP following the independent audit, the more funding is made available to the club, alongside signification financial commitments from the clubs at each category.

    Key Principals

    There are six fundamental principles that have been highlighted as key to the success of the EPPP, and will be achieved by focusing on coaching, classification, compensation, and education.

    1. Increase the number and quality of home grown players gaining professional contracts in the clubs and playing first team football at the highest level.

    2. Create more time for players to play and be coached.

    3. Improve coaching provision.

    4. Implement a system of effective measurement and quality assurance.

    5. Positively influence strategic investment into the Academy System demonstrating value for money.

    6. Seek to implement significant gains in every aspect of player development.

    A focus of the EPPP is to allow players more time to practice with their coaches, as well as fostering links with local schools to not only aid players in their development as a footballer, but also to help nurture young players from an academic point of view.

    Birmingham City Official Player Recruitment Process

    The player recruitment department is tasked with the monitoring, selection and transition of players operating outside of our Academy environment. The recruitment team will work collectively with our coaches to prioritise the identification of players within the three phases of the player pathway.

    The priority of the department is to recruit, develop and produce players able to reach the Academy’s core purpose. This process is player centered, focusing on the identification of players able to excel in one or more of the four corners associated to player development and, where possible predominantly recruit from a catchment area within an hour of Birmingham. The strategy will be collaborative in nature, planned and aligned to the profiles through each of the development phases where appropriate.

    PRE-ACADEMY

    The Pre-Academy is a development programme designed to identify, assess and nurture local talented individuals between 6 - 8 years of age. The primary aim is to develop technically gifted individuals for our U9’s squads who become accustomed to the club’s culture and playing philosophy through weekly training sessions and games, allowing for an easy transition into the Academy way of life. The major emphasis of the programme is technical development. With the use of the clubs training facilities, and a structured coaching syllabus and games programme, our UEFA qualified Academy staff seek to increase player to ball contact time in a fun, inclusive and professional environment.

    COMMUNITY TRUST

    The Club has a very large Community Trust scheme operating a number of local coaching programmes. The Community Trust run a shadow squad programme for U12-U14 players participating on a weekly basis in a number of local grass root leagues. There is also a full time programme for the U17-U19’s.

    Players from within the Community Trust programme can be directly recommended by a member of staff for a trial period. In addition to this, each Community Trust coach working within the shadow squad and on the U17-19 programme acts as a spotter, recommending opposition players they have seen in the fixtures that their respective teams have participated in.

    SCHOOLS FOOTBALL PROGRAMME

    Within the West Midlands area there is a thriving schools football programme. Through community links, it has been identified that there are some young players who only participate in schools’ football and may not be observed participating in local grass root fixtures. There are a number of reasons for this, the most common being a recent move to the area or little/no parental support.

    The Academy continually supports West Midland District Schools at both primary and secondary level allowing the use of the training facilities for prestigious games in their calendar. School staff are also invited to Academy CPD events in order to aid their development as coaches. This relationship means there is the opportunity for talented players who are identified by school staff to be recommended directly to the Recruitment Manager/Officer. This may lead to an observation, and if suitable, an invitation to the Academy trial process.

    The Derby County Development Centre trials take place on a regular basis during the year.

    The Academy holds a series of Open Trial Evenings to find the best young male talent in the Derbyshire, Staffordshire, Leicestershire and Nottinghamshire area.

    Since the Development Centres were originally set up, over 70 players have progressed through the Development Centre system to sign for Derby County’s Academy.

    Last season, 10 players made the step from the Development Centre to the Derby County Academy, ranging from Under 8s through to Under 15s.

    The Development Centre gives children the opportunity to train free of charge on a weekly basis, in an environment that will develop them technically, tactically, psychologically and socially.

    Successful trialists will earn a place at their chosen trial venue or given the opportunity in the Rams' shadow squads or Academy.

    Request a Trial with Ipswich Town FC Academy

    In an effort to avoid your disappointment, Ipswich Town Football Club will not normally invite a player in for a trial unless one of our scouts has seen him play and thinks he is of the required standard. Our scouts continually watch the best standard, and teams, of football in their allocated areas, and they will only recommend a player for trials who they feel has a high level of all-round ability, along with the attributes required to become a professional footballer.

    Players should be playing regularly for a club. Players aged 16-18 should be playing at a competitive standard (we would suggest at least semi professional non-League football). You should also hold a British or EU passport, or have ‘leave to remain’ in this country. If the above applies to you send a football CV

    COVENTRY CITY DEVELOPMENT CENTRE | U7 -U23

    If interested in a free trial please email This email address is being protected from spambots. You need JavaScript enabled to view it.

    Sky Blues in the Community at times hold open trials for the Player Development Centre scheme for u6 to u18

    The Player Development Centre initiative offers advanced football coaching with a technical and tactical focus for children of all footballing abilities and experiences. We have a strong believe that for players to be able to develop and reach their potential they need to train and play with others of a similar level. For this reason we have a player pathway in place where players can move up or down so we can make sure they are in a group which is both challenging but also gives them a chance to have success.

    The overriding mission statement for SBitC Player Development Centres is ‘To provide high quality coaching and a positive coaching environment to support players in reaching their potential’. We achieve this by providing a positive learning environment that focusses on each individual player, rather than team results.

    We understand that all players are different, which is why we follow the FA ‘Four Corner Model’, which looks at the whole player including: Technical/Tactical, Physical, Social and Physiological areas of their game. 

    We don’t promise that players involved in our PDCs will become professional footballers, but what we do guarantee is a high quality coaching environment that improves the technical and tactical understanding of those who attend.

    SBITC are a registered charity, therefore a not-for-profit organisation. This means that all costs involved in PDCs cover the costs of running the centre, rather than begin focused on making profit.

    Open Trial information & dates:

    The open trials normally run over a 5 week period. On the first week we put all the new players together for an initial assessment from which they are then allocated a group to train with our existing players for the following 4 weeks. Depending how many new players we have attend we will also try our best to offer players the opportunity to play in at least one match during this period. We find that by seeing the players over this period of time and at both training and games gives us the best opportunity of identifying which level on our pathway best suits them.

    The club’s Academy of Light opened its doors in 2003 and is rightly considered amongst the best football training facilities in Europe.

    The club’s players have access to magnificent facilities, including a hydrotherapy pool, top-class medical care and an indoor barn featuring a 4G synthetic pitch as well as up to 18 outdoor pitches.

    The low-profile buildings are deceptive – the lower floor is completely below ground level and packs in more than can be imagined from the outside!

    It’s a far cry from the club’s previous training ground, the Charlie Hurley Centre, which was made up of temporary buildings including an old cricket pavilion.

    OUR PHILOSOPHY

    The Academy aims to be professional, approachable and friendly and will give young players the best chance to develop on the pitch as well as socially and academically.

    We have a responsibility to develop young players in a challenging, safe and supportive environment with committed and experienced members of staff.

    We strive to create an environment where developing players are encouraged to experiment, make errors and express themselves.

    A system is in place which allows young players to progress to the first-team squad if they are prepared to work hard, be open-minded and stay committed.

    Players will be treated fairly and will receive advice and feedback as part of a holistic approach which will produce young men and footballers we can all be proud of.

    The educational development of every young footballer is a key part of Academy life, and we take our commitment to education seriously.

    We firmly believe in lifelong learning and the holistic development of every Academy player.

    This, together with our opinion that success is a journey not a destination, forms the foundation of our mission statement.

    All full-time scholars embark on an Advanced Apprenticeship in Sporting Excellence (AASE). The apprenticeship is comprised of a Level 3 NVQ Diploma plus an educational component. 

    Most scholars will study for a BTEC Level 3 in Sport as part of their education and this is equivalent to two A-Levels.

    The scholars also graduate from the Academy, whether to the professional game or elsewhere, with a referee’s qualification and an FA Level 2 Certificate in Coaching Football.

    The Academy is home to all the club’s representative teams, from the youngest age groups through to the U18, U21 and senior squads as well as the Sunderland Ladies team.
